The Sorcerer's Totem: A Tale of Power and Magic

Andrew Robinson is a budding sorcerer from a world where totems reign supreme. But here's the thing. Andrew's totem is considered worthless by his family. Talk about a tough break! But Andrew is not one to give up easily, especially after experiencing a rebirth. He's determined to prove everyone wrong and unlock his totem's hidden potential. With vast experiences from his previous life, Andrew finds a way to enhance his abilities and become more powerful than anyone could have ever imagined. His hard work and persistence pay off as he transforms into a true magic anomaly with the power to alter the fortunes and features of everything connected to him. Armed with his trusty Book Totem, Andrew never encounters any obstacles in his quest for power. He can always rely on his reserves of origin and fate energy to edit the levels of his attributes, skills, and contracted companions. He only needs to accumulate the required energy before raising his sorcery powers with the power of his Book Totem. Facing Off against the Demon Princess

Andrew stood there, heart racing with excitement and exhilaration. He had just defeated not one but two terrifying demons in a matter of seconds. His body still buzzed with the adrenaline rush of battle, and his mind raced with the memory of the intense fight.

Despite the danger, he had held his ground and emerged victorious, and the sense of triumph was still coursing through his veins like a powerful drug. The satisfaction of defeating those monsters was indescribable, and he couldn't help but feel like a true hero.

The feeling of success was overwhelming, but he knew better than to let it cloud his judgment. He needed to act fast before the fearsome demon princess, Anabel, could track him down. His best bet was to remain in hiding while waiting for the perfect opportunity to strike.

But just as he was about to cast his [greater invisibility] spell and vanish from sight, he suddenly felt a jolt of electricity run through his body, leaving him gasping for breath.

His heart pounded, and his blood churned as something incredible happened to him. It was as if a mysterious force within him had been awakened, drawing out some powerful and mystical energy from the 'very' corpses of the demons he had just slain.

His eyes widened in amazement, and he whispered, "Could this be my newly awakened Valkyrie spirit body at work?"

He felt a sense of eager anticipation as he perceived the energy emanating from the lifeless bodies and dissipating somewhere within him. Gradually, he became more convinced of his theory regarding this mysterious phenomenon.

His Valkyrie bloodline had given him two inherent abilities: the Valkyrie transcendent eyes and the Valkyrie spirit body.

The transcendent eyes granted him the power to see through the essence of things, using knowledge from the vast Valkyrie bloodline library. As for the spirit body, it was a mysterious physique that allowed him numerous advantages, such as heightened mana affinity and the ability to absorb intrinsic energy from any being he killed. It was like a superior form of Aeon's Blessing of Death.

Andrew felt a rush of excitement coursing through his body as he tapped into the siphoning ability of his Valkyrie spirit form.

But as he glanced at the two demon corpses lying on the ground, he couldn't help but notice that their once imposing muscles had shrunk to a fraction of their former size. It was a powerful reminder of the shocking potency of the Valkyrie ability and the deadly consequences that could come with it.

With a determined look on his face, he made a promise to himself that no one else should ever find out about his unique ability. It was a secret he had to keep at all costs, even if it meant living in solitude for the rest of his life.

Suddenly, Andrew's body tensed up as a wave of cold fear washed over him.

His survival instinct kicked in, and he moved with lightning speed, narrowly avoiding a black arrow that whizzed past his face and buried itself in a tree trunk. His heart raced in his chest as he realized just how close he had come to meet his demise.

A mischievous voice broke the silence, "Well, well, well... Look who managed to dodge my Blackwing Arrow! You're quite the escape artist, aren't you?"

As Andrew looked up, he caught sight of Anabel, the demon princess, making her way toward him with a bow in hand.

He knew that despite her innocent and Loli appearance, she possessed formidable strength and sorcery that couldn't be underestimated. Andrew had planned to ambush her, but it was too late now. He sighed with frustration as he realized he had lost his chance to catch her off guard.

In the meantime, Anabel approached with a sly smirk and greeted, "Big brother! We meet again." As she drew closer, she noticed the two demon corpses lying on the ground, and her expression turned serious. "Impressive! You managed to take down my two worthless subordinates in mere seconds. It seems like you have gained immense strength after inheriting Aeon's legacy. I can't help but wonder, how many rank-one spells have you mastered? If you don't mind sharing, that is."

As the enemy approached, Andrew stood his ground without uttering a word. He was never one to engage in meaningless conversation during a battle.

With a deep breath, his demeanor changed, seemingly as if he had suddenly transformed into a completely different person.

His vast experiences from his past life came flooding back, and he prepared himself for the impending fight. His heart raced like that of a predator on the prowl, and his piercing blue eyes radiated an icy stare as he locked gazes with the demon girl in front of him.

"Hey, why so serious?" Anabel teased Andrew with a playful smirk. "What's with those eyes? Are you trying to scare a little girl like me to death?"

Andrew remained silent and went into action before the demon princess could utter another word.

He wasted no time and unleashed his innate rank-one [shadow jump] spell by channeling five units of mana and mentality through his book totem. In an instant, Andrew vanished from his spot and reappeared behind Anabel, his silhouette flickering into existence from her shadow like a ghost.

The demon princess was no ordinary foe. She was a skilled rank-one spell caster with incredible agility and sharp battle instincts. But even she was caught off guard by Andrew's swift move. She didn't have enough time to turn around and counter him, so she quickly activated one of her defensive artifacts, prompting a grey fluid-like shield to cover her back and protect her from any potential attack.

Andrew remained unfazed as he glanced at the magical shield. With a lightning-swift move, he unsheathed Shadow Fang, his newly acquired saint dagger, and plunged it toward Anabel's heart.

Its anti-magic property, coupled with its incredible sharpness, immediately came into play. Its blade flickered with a sinister glint as it shattered Anabel's magical shield like a balloon before continuing forward with the impetus of a reaper's scythe. It was a move that would determine the fate of the battle.

"No..." Anabel let out a terrified shriek as the dagger sank into her back.

But Andrew showed no mercy and shoved the entire length of the blade into her back until it came out from the other side. Moreover, he didn't just stop at that. His eyes remained emotionless as he withdrew the dagger before stabbing again and again and again.

Blood spattered his face and soaked his clothes, but he didn't stop until he had let out all his pent-up hatred for the demons. As he stood there, breath heaving, he felt a sudden surge of power coursing through his veins.

His Valkyrie spirit body had been triggered again, and he could sense it siphoning the slain demon's intrinsic energy away. It was a moment of pure satisfaction, knowing he had delivered a critical blow to the forces of darkness that threatened his world.
